Justin:
Aroma - It's got a big caramel and bread crust quality to it that actually pops out more than the hops. There is also a small bit sulfur at the end. The hops are mostly earthy with a little bit of floral. |
Score: 9/12 |
Appearance - The beer is a clear gold with a fluffy white head made up of tight bubbles. |
Score: 3/3 |
Flavor - The bitterness is what gets me first because it wasn't expected. The malts are slight caramel, pie crust, bread crust and wheat bread. The hops are mostly spicy and provide a nice, bitter base. |
Score: 15/20 |
Mouthfeel - The body is medium and the carbonation is above medium for a crisp feel. |
Score: 3/5 |
Overall Impression - This one is very drinkable but it's "light" in aroma and flavor for the style. As an APA, this would do quite well but as an IPA I was looking for a little bit more. |
Score: 7/10 |
